OPTIMIZE THE POTENTIAL FOR CUSTOMERS TO FIND YOUR SALES

It is important to understand that your listing titles and descriptions provide the most important place for attracting customers to your auction.  Generating plenty of relevant, search-friendly content in your ads, coupled with great titles, is critical to getting the best advantage afforded by eBay search engines so that your pages show up as most relevant in the searches.

TITLE:  The listing title should include a minimum of 1-3 relevant, keywords or keyword phrases.  Since I sell clothing, my keywords always include the Manufacturer name, fabric tyle (Linen, silk, Poly etc.), item type (maybe even several word options for the item type such as shirt, blouse and top if space allows), and tag size.  Additionally, as space allows, I add item color and condition.  Color and condition are less searched than type of item, fabric and manufacturer.  Using a good formula for your headline and making it a habit to use it when you write your titles, is both great search engine optimization practice and will assure a steady flow of customers interested in what you are selling. Less guesswork -- a much more focussed approach. 

AD COPY:  Your ad should include at least 200 words of copy.  The ad should have a complete description of the item for sale, including age and any and all faults. 

Be sure to use those most important keywords and phrases at the beginning and at the end of the ad (including at least those mentioned in the title as discussed above). 

An additional best practice is to include the frequent use of keywords in the copy as well as using attention getting formatting to include bold lettering, clear font type (Verdana and Arial are much easier to read than Times New Roman and you do want your ad top be read if at al possible).  Don't forget to include the item size and/or dimentions.  In clothing both tag size and dimensions are critical because clothing manufacturers size so differently that nothing is predictable by tag size alone.  This is especially on important titles and keywords.
